# Constants for the Pedalport rebalancing planner.
#
# These thresholds decide when a dock is flagged as starved or
# saturated and how aggressively vans are dispatched. If you are
# on call and rebalancing looks wrong, check these before touching
# the solver itself. The values currently in effect are as follows.

tuning table, kajog-kawef:
PRIORITIES = {
    "kelox": 870,
    "kasix": 89,
    "eliax": 988,
}

Document Transport — Print Shop Master Copies

Quick guide for moving master copies to Bramblehurst Print Co. These are the only originals, so treat the run like a valuables transfer, not a regular parcel drop. Use the red tamper-evident envelopes from the supply shelf, log the seal number in the transport book, and never combine the run with general mail. The masters go directly to the press supervisor, nobody else. On arrival, the courier must follow the hand-over instruction stated below.

drop instructions, kajep-tageg: the kasvan casdor courier leaves the quenvan quenox druox ledger at gate 4316 under passcode 799004

- [ ] Step 7: Archive cold storage buckets (Glacierline tier). Confirm both ceremony witnesses are present, verify bucket manifests match the Oxbow ledger, then seal the archive key shares. Plugin authors may observe but not handle shares. Once sealed, the archive index itself is encrypted and can only be reopened with the passphrase below.

vault phrase of badup-hahig = tamael-aldael-kelmir-istael-fenok-istwyn-tamius-jorath-oliion